How is pregnancy symbolism interpreted in the Bible?

Pregnancy symbolism in the Bible is often associated with the fruit of the Spirit. According to Galatians 5:22-26, the fruit of the Spirit are love, joy, peace, patience, kindness, goodness, faithfulness, gentleness, and self-control. Dreaming of pregnancy may indicate that you are growing in these virtues.
